20 Jul 2007 Fri 08:41 pm |
A new English newspaper started in January 2006 and you can access it on the web free!
It has an Expat page and it includes the columnist, Charlotte, who writes things that help you understand the culture better and the lawyer, Berk Cenktir, who gives help on legal mattters. Enjoy!
Today's Zaman English newspaper

21 Jun 2010 Mon 10:06 am |
www.turkeytravelplanner.com
This is a great website started by an American guy who lives in Turkey, Tom Brosnahan. He has thousands of pages to help you plan your trip to Turkey as well as useful information about customs, visas, marriage in Turkey, and culture. There are also some great photos. This website is mostly for tourists, but can also be useful for people who want to live there.
